import QWeb from "./qweb";
import { Context } from "./qweb";
interface CompilationInfo {
nodeID?: string;
node: Element;
qweb: QWeb;
ctx: Context;
fullName: string;
value: string;
}
export interface Directive {
name: string;
priority: number;
// if return true, then directive is fully applied and there is no need to
// keep processing node. Otherwise, we keep going.
atNodeEncounter?(info: CompilationInfo): boolean;
atNodeCreation?(info: CompilationInfo);
finalize?(info: CompilationInfo);
}
const forEachDirective: Directive = {
name: "foreach",
priority: 10,
atNodeEncounter({ node, qweb, ctx }): boolean {
const elems = node.getAttribute("t-foreach")!;
const name = node.getAttribute("t-as")!;
let arrayID = ctx.generateID();
ctx.addLine(`let ${arrayID} = ${qweb._formatExpression(elems)}`);
ctx.addLine(
`if (typeof ${arrayID} === 'number') { ${arrayID} = Array.from(Array(${arrayID}).keys())}`
);
let keysID = ctx.generateID();
ctx.addLine(
`let ${keysID} = ${arrayID} instanceof Array ? ${arrayID} : Object.keys(${arrayID})`
);
let valuesID = ctx.generateID();
ctx.addLine(
`let ${valuesID} = ${arrayID} instanceof Array ? ${arrayID} : Object.values(${arrayID})`
);
ctx.addLine(`for (let i = 0; i < ${keysID}.length; i++) {`);
ctx.indent();
ctx.addLine(`context.${name}_first = i === 0`);
ctx.addLine(`context.${name}_last = i === ${keysID}.length - 1`);
ctx.addLine(`context.${name}_parity = i % 2 === 0 ? 'even' : 'odd'`);
ctx.addLine(`context.${name}_index = i`);
ctx.addLine(`context.${name} = ${keysID}[i]`);
ctx.addLine(`context.${name}_value = ${valuesID}[i]`);
const nodes = Array.from(node.childNodes);
for (let i = 0; i < nodes.length; i++) {
qweb._compileNode(nodes[i], ctx);
}
ctx.dedent();
ctx.addLine("}");
return true;
}
};
const ifDirective: Directive = {
name: "if",
priority: 20,
atNodeEncounter({ node, qweb, ctx }): boolean {
let cond = qweb._getValue(node.getAttribute("t-if")!, ctx);
ctx.addLine(`if (${qweb._formatExpression(cond)}) {`);
ctx.indent();
return false;
},
finalize({ ctx }) {
ctx.dedent();
ctx.addLine(`}`);
}
};
const elifDirective: Directive = {
name: "elif",
priority: 30,
atNodeEncounter({ node, qweb, ctx }): boolean {
let cond = qweb._getValue(node.getAttribute("t-elif")!, ctx);
ctx.addLine(`else if (${qweb._formatExpression(cond)}) {`);
ctx.indent();
return false;
},
finalize({ ctx }) {
ctx.dedent();
ctx.addLine(`}`);
}
};
const elseDirective: Directive = {
name: "else",
priority: 40,
atNodeEncounter({ ctx }): boolean {
ctx.addLine(`else {`);
ctx.indent();
return false;
},
finalize({ ctx }) {
ctx.dedent();
ctx.addLine(`}`);
}
};
const callDirective: Directive = {
name: "call",
priority: 50,
atNodeEncounter({ node, qweb, ctx }): boolean {
const subTemplate = node.getAttribute("t-call")!;
const nodeTemplate = qweb.nodeTemplates[subTemplate];
const nodeCopy = <Element>node.cloneNode(true);
nodeCopy.removeAttribute("t-call");
// extract variables from nodecopy
const tempCtx = new Context();
qweb._compileNode(nodeCopy, tempCtx);
const vars = Object.assign({}, ctx.variables, tempCtx.variables);
const subCtx = ctx.withCaller(nodeCopy).withVariables(vars);
qweb._compileNode(nodeTemplate.firstChild!, subCtx);
return true;
}
};
const setDirective: Directive = {
name: "set",
priority: 60,
atNodeEncounter({ node, ctx }): boolean {
const variable = node.getAttribute("t-set")!;
let value = node.getAttribute("t-value")!;
if (value) {
ctx.variables[variable] = value;
} else {
ctx.variables[variable] = node.childNodes;
}
return true;
}
};
function compileValueNode(value: any, node: Element, qweb: QWeb, ctx: Context) {
if (value === "0" && ctx.caller) {
qweb._compileNode(ctx.caller, ctx);
return;
}
if (typeof value === "string") {
const exprID = ctx.generateID();
ctx.addLine(`let ${exprID} = ${qweb._formatExpression(value)}`);
ctx.addLine(`if (${exprID} || ${exprID} === 0) {`);
ctx.indent();
let text = exprID;
if (ctx.escaping) {
text = `this.escape(${text})`;
}
const nodeID = ctx.generateID();
ctx.addLine(`let ${nodeID} = document.createTextNode(${text})`);
ctx.addNode(nodeID);
ctx.dedent();
if (node.childNodes.length) {
ctx.addLine("} else {");
ctx.indent();
qweb._compileChildren(node, ctx);
ctx.dedent();
}
ctx.addLine("}");
return;
}
if (value instanceof NodeList) {
for (let node of Array.from(value)) {
qweb._compileNode(<ChildNode>node, ctx);
}
}
}
const escDirective: Directive = {
name: "esc",
priority: 70,
atNodeEncounter({ node, qweb, ctx }): boolean {
if (node.nodeName !== "t") {
let nodeID = qweb._compileGenericNode(node, ctx);
ctx = ctx.withParent(nodeID);
}
let value = qweb._getValue(node.getAttribute("t-esc")!, ctx);
compileValueNode(value, node, qweb, ctx.withEscaping());
return true;
}
};
const rawDirective: Directive = {
name: "raw",
priority: 80,
atNodeEncounter({ node, qweb, ctx }): boolean {
if (node.nodeName !== "t") {
let nodeID = qweb._compileGenericNode(node, ctx);
ctx = ctx.withParent(nodeID);
}
let value = qweb._getValue(node.getAttribute("t-raw")!, ctx);
compileValueNode(value, node, qweb, ctx);
return true;
}
};
const onDirective: Directive = {
name: "on",
priority: 90,
atNodeCreation({ ctx, fullName, value, nodeID }) {
const eventName = fullName.slice(5);
let extraArgs;
let handler = value.replace(/\(.*\)/, function(args) {
extraArgs = args.slice(1, -1);
return "";
});
ctx.addLine(
`${nodeID}.addEventListener('${eventName}', context['${handler}'].bind(context${
extraArgs ? ", " + extraArgs : ""
}))`
);
}
};
export default [
forEachDirective,
ifDirective,
elifDirective,
elseDirective,
callDirective,
setDirective,
escDirective,
rawDirective,
onDirective
];
